D-SOLVE Cohorts (Cohort a and B)
About This Trial
Hepatitis D is by far the most severe form of chronic viral hepatitis, frequently leading to liver failure, hepatocellular carcinoma and death. Hepatitis D is caused by coinfection Hepatitis D is caused by co-infection with hepatitis B virus (HBV) and hepatitis D virus (HDV). This multicenter cohort should enable a comprehensive and unbiased biomarker screening of well-defined HDV-infected patients, followed by mechanistic studies to determine the functional role of distinct molecules. Patient surveillance strategies and antiviral treatment approaches could be personalized which should reduce clinical and social disease burden, improve quality of life and save direct and indirect costs caused by HDV infection.
Who May Be Eligible (Plain English)
Who May Qualify:
- Anti-HDV positive
- ≥18 years old
- Sex: m/f/d
- willing to sign a consent form for prospective procedures
Who Should NOT Join This Trial:
- Anti-HDV negative
